Polycystic kidney disease in a family of Persian cats

J Am Vet Med Assoc. 1990 Apr 15;196(8):1288-90.

Abstract

A 6-year-old Persian cat was determined to have polycystic kidney disease (PKD). Because of 3 previous clinical reports of PKD in Persian cats, the offspring were examined by use of ultrasonography, which provided evidence of PKD in 3 of the 4 offspring. Because of the genetic transmission of this disease, breeders should be advised not to breed PKD-positive Persian cats.
